Key Components of Industrial Lighting Installation Specifications
The following are some of the key components that are typically included in industrial lighting installation specifications:
1. Lighting Levels: Specifications define the minimum and maximum light levels required in different areas of the facility. These levels are often determined based on the type of work being performed.
2. Lighting Fixtures: The specifications detail the types of lighting fixtures to be used, including their size, type (e.g., fluorescent, LED), and mounting options.
3. Control Systems: These include timers, dimmers, and sensors that control the lighting based on the time of day, occupancy, or natural light levels.
4. Emergency Lighting: Specifications outline the requirements for emergency lighting systems, which must provide illumination during power outages or other emergencies.
5. Cable and Wiring: Guidelines for the installation of cables and wiring are provided to ensure safety and proper functioning of the lighting system.
Design Considerations
When designing an industrial lighting system, several factors must be considered:
1. Work Environment: The nature of the work, the presence of dust or fumes, and the risk of chemical exposure can all influence the type of lighting required.
2. Space Configuration: The layout of the facility, including the height of ceilings and the presence of obstructions, affects the lighting design.
3. Lighting Control: The ability to control lighting levels and direction is crucial for optimizing energy use and achieving the desired illumination.
4. Maintenance: Specifications should include guidelines for regular maintenance to ensure the longevity and efficiency of the lighting system.
